OIL SYSTEM - DISASSEMBLY, INSPECTION AND REASSEMBLY
4 - 6
1. Oil
Pump
Inspecting the oil pump
Check the oil pump for any damage, and whether
or not it rotates smoothly. If faulty, replace the
entire pump assembly.
2. Relief
Valve
Inspecting the relief valve
(1)
Inspect for proper valve-to-seat contact, spring
fatigue, breakage or any other damage. If faulty,
replace.
(2)
Measure the relief valve opening pressure (at
rated engine speed). If the measured pressure
exceeds the standard value, remove the cap nut
and adjust by shimming.
(3)
Engine oil pressure port: Right-hand side of
engine
Relief valve opening pressure
0.35
±
0.05 MPa
(3.5
±
0.5 kgf/cm
2
)
[50
±
7.2 psi]
